This special edition of 'Growing Peas for Canning and Freezing' was written by the U.S. Department of Agriculture, and first published in 1942. The book covers topics including Canning and Freezing, Climatic Requirements of the Pea Crop, Crop Rotations, Soils and Their Treatment, Varieties, Seeding, Weed Control, Harvesting, plus more.
